Former Toronto Maple Leafs general manager Kyle Dubas is not a very popular guy these days and his recent oversight is not going to do him any favors.
He is a controversial figure in the city because the team he constructed never went very deep in the playoffs. Of course, now,
they look better than ever.However, Dubas is currently catching heat because of a player he missed out on a few years ago. That player being
Dylan Strome.
Kyle Dubas missed the boat on Dylan Strome
When Strome left the Chicago Blackhawks and was acquired by the Washington Capitals, it was believed that he would be a great value player.
He has three 20-goal seasons in a row, but as it turns out, the
Leafs never even sent him an offer despite the reports that they did.
Wanted Strome on the Leafs bad when Chicago didn't qualify him. Was told by many he was too slow and bad defensively. A friend bumped into him at the CNE that summer and asked him why he didn't sign with the Leafs. Apparently never got an offer
Strome seemed interested in Toronto, but the interest from Dubas was not mutual. Recently, Strome revealed just how much he loves playing in Washington.
«I thought I might never get to this point - where I might never be on a team like this, in a city like this. I don't take any of this for granted.»
Needless to say, the Toronto Maple Leafs completely missed out on what could have been the perfect player for this team's middle six.
For now, the Leafs can only focus on what is in front of them, which is the NHL Playoffs. They are currently up 2-0 on the Ottawa Senators and they will be trying to put the series away as the week continues.
